Create a shortcut on the desktop by right-clicking, pressing new, then shortcut.

Paste this into the location box: "%PROGRAMFILES%\Steam\steamapps\common\Blockland\Blockland.exe" ptlaaxobimwroe -dedicated -map skylands

if it gives you an error then try pasting this instead: "%PROGRAMFILES(x86)%\Steam\steamapps\common\Blockland\Blockland.exe" ptlaaxobimwroe -dedicated -map skylands

After successful continue the wizard until done, then open the shortcut.
